The key to this controversy is necessary cleaning. If you have a roommate, with whom you have split all the rent and security deposit, and then you leave, the landlord DOES NOT have to give youyourpart of the security deposit back, absent an express agreement otherwise with the landlord. Similarly, a few small nail holes would be wear and tear, while large holes in the wall can be classified as damage. Similarly, the faucet that breaks off in your hand from metal fatigue, or the drawer that comes apart when you simply open it, are not damages caused by you in the legal sense. In California, the tenant is NOT entitled to any interest on the security deposit held by the landlord UNLESS it is required by a local rent control ordinance or the rental contract, itself. However, a large number of holes in the walls or ceiling that require filling with plaster, or that otherwise require patching and repainting, could justify withholding the cost of repainting from the tenant's security deposit. If the purpose of the money is essentially to protect the landlord against your failure to take care of the property or pay your rent, it is a security deposit, under the law, no matter what name the landlord gives it.
